About the Role

The Engineering Planner is responsible for owning the planning and scheduling of all preventive, planned and corrective maintenance activities. Working closely with the Engineering Manager, Operations and wider Engineering team, you will ensure maintenance work is well prepared, prioritised and delivered safely, efficiently and in line with site and business objectives.

This is a key role in reducing reactive maintenance, improving asset health and supporting consistent operational performance in a fast-paced manufacturing environment.

Key Responsibilities
  • Own the end-to-end planning and scheduling of preventive, planned and corrective maintenance activities, ensuring work is optimised, prioritised and scheduled at least one week in advance where practicable
  • Develop, maintain and continuously improve high-quality maintenance plans, including accurate labour, materials, tooling, permits and operational requirements
  • Build and maintain a credible, achievable weekly maintenance schedule aligned to site priorities, labour availability and operational constraints
  • Lead the weekly scheduling process, ensuring clear communication, challenge and commitment from Engineering, Operations and key stakeholders
  • Maintain accurate, complete and reliable CMMS (SAP) data, including work orders, task lists, asset care plans, Bills of Materials and maintenance history
  • Act as the Engineering SAP key user for the site, supporting standard ways of working, system compliance and UK SAP governance requirements
  • Monitor maintenance performance through agreed KPIs, using data to improve schedule compliance, reduce downtime and support effective decision making
  • Ensure all planned maintenance activities comply with DS Smith Health, Safety and Environmental standards, embedding safety into all work planning
  • Drive continuous improvement in planning and scheduling processes, challenging inefficiencies and supporting root cause analysis and improvement activities
